nutritionalCONSULTING
The work of a nutritional consultant involves offering nutritional guidance and recommendations to companies, including foodservice establishments.
​
She can assist in developing balanced and healthy menus, taking into account the nutritional needs of customers and regulatory guidelines.
​
If the establishment develops its own products, the consultant can assist with various issues such as labeling and packaging.
​
In addition, the nutritional consultant can help implement good food handling practices, train the kitchen staff, and conduct periodic evaluations to ensure food quality and safety.
​
Having a nutritional consultant can bring benefits such as improving the quality of food served, meeting customer demands for healthy options, reducing waste, increasing customer satisfaction, and strengthening the company's image as concerned with health and well-being.
